Dario Aprea wrote
>I've just installed slackware-10.1 and tried to install om from cvs.
>Slackware comes with gtk-2.0, libgnomecanvas-2.0 and libglade-2.0
>preinstalled. I had to compile and install libsigc++-2.0.15,
>glibmm-2.6.1, gktmm-2.6.3, libgnomecanvasmm-2.10.0 and
>libglademm-2.6.0. Everything compiled fine, both the libraries and om.
>The om server runs without problems, but om_gtk gives me lots of
>errors. Any idea?
>
>Maybe the problem is between gtk and gtkmm. I don't have any program
>that uses gtkmm, so I can't try if it works.
>
>What versions of those library are you using? Maybe knowing that could
>help.
[snip]

Yes, it's a version problem (ie a bug) with libglademm (not libglade).  
Unfortunately it seems a bit random what version causes the problems 
(and I don't recall what version I'm running at home), but the problem 
has always been solved by people up (or down?) grading libglademm.

If you switch versions and it fixes it, please reply to the list with 
the version that didn't work, and the version that works, along with 
your distro, and we can start figuring out where the problem actually 
lies.
